Oracle RAC 重啟數據庫文章

一、準備工作

在重啟 Oracle RAC 數據庫之前,需要確保已經完成了以下準備工作:
1. 確認數據庫狀態:確認數據庫是否處于正常工作狀態,如有必要,可以先進行備份。
2. 備份數據:在重啟數據庫之前,建議先備份數據,以防止數據丟失。
3. 檢查系統資源:確認系統資源是否足夠,如 CPU、內存、磁盤空間等。
4. 檢查網絡連接:確認所有網絡連接是否正常,包括內部網絡和外部網絡。
5. 確認集群狀態:確認集群中的所有節點是否都處于正常工作狀態。
二、停止數據庫

在停止數據庫之前,需要確保已經完成了以下工作:
1. 確認數據庫狀態:確認數據庫是否處于正常工作狀態。
2. 關閉 Oracle 服務:在命令行中使用以下命令關閉 Oracle 服務:
```shell
sqlplus / as sysdba
shudow immediae;
```
3. 確認 Oracle 服務已停止:使用以下命令檢查 Oracle 服務是否已停止:
```perl
ps -ef | grep pmo
```
如果該命令沒有輸出,則表示 Oracle 服務已經停止。
三、啟動數據庫

在啟動數據庫之前,需要確保已經完成了以下工作:
1. 檢查節點狀態:確認所有節點都處于正常工作狀態。
2. 啟動 Oracle 服務:在命令行中使用以下命令啟動 Oracle 服務:
```shell
sqlplus / as sysdba
sarup;
```
3. 確認數據庫已啟動:使用以下命令檢查數據庫是否已啟動:
```perl
sqlplus / as sysdba
selec isace_ame, saus from v$isace;
```
如果輸出中的
四、驗證數據庫狀態

在驗證數據庫狀態之前,需要確保已經完成了以下工作:
1. 確認數據庫已啟動:使用以下命令檢查數據庫是否已啟動:
一、準備工作

在重啟 Oracle RAC 數據庫之前,需要確保已經完成了以下準備工作:
1. 確認數據庫狀態:確認數據庫是否處于正常工作狀態,如有必要,可以先進行備份。
2. 備份數據:在重啟數據庫之前,建議先備份數據,以防止數據丟失。
3. 檢查系統資源:確認系統資源是否足夠,如 CPU、內存、磁盤空間等。
4. 檢查網絡連接:確認所有網絡連接是否正常,包括內部網絡和外部網絡。
5. 確認集群狀態:確認集群中的所有節點是否都處于正常工作狀態。
二、停止數據庫

在停止數據庫之前,需要先確認數據庫的狀態,然后使用以下命令停止數據庫:
1. 以正常模式關閉數據庫:sqlplus / as sysdba u003cu003cEOF; shudow immediae; exi; EOF;
2. 如果數據庫處于掛起狀態,可以使用以下命令關閉數據庫:sqlplus / as sysdba u003cu003cEOF; shudow force; exi; EOF;
三、啟動數據庫

在啟動數據庫之前,需要先確認所有節點都已經處于正常工作狀態,然后使用以下命令啟動數據庫:
1. 啟動實例:sqlplus / as sysdba u003cu003cEOF; sarup omou; exi; EOF;
2. 掛載數據庫:sqlplus / as sysdba u003cu003cEOF; aler daabase mou; exi; EOF;
3. 打開數據庫:sqlplus / as sysdba u003cu003cEOF; aler daabase ope; exi; EOF;
四、驗證數據庫狀態

在啟動數據庫之后,需要驗證數據庫是否處于正常工作狀態,可以使用以下命令進行驗證:
1. 查看數據庫狀態:sqlplus / as sysdba u003cu003cEOF; selec isace_ame, saus from v$isace; exi; EOF;
2. 查看表空間狀態:sqlplus / as sysdba u003cu003cEOF; selec ablespace_ame, saus from dba_ablespaces; exi; EOF;
3. 查看數據文件狀態:sqlplus / as sysdba u003cu003cEOF; selec file_ame, saus from v$daafile; exi; EOF;
5. 系統資源不足:如果系統資源不足,可以嘗試增加資源或減少數據庫負載。
下一篇:硬盤修復工具軟件